Ingredients
1head cauliflowercut into florets
1tablespoonextra virgin olive oil
1poundground beef
1/2onionlarge, chopped
2clovegarlicminced
1cupmarinara sauce
14.5ouncecanned diced tomatoes
1/2cupfresh basilchopped, divided
1cupshredded mozzarella cheese
1/2teaspoonsea saltmore or less to taste or dietary restriction
1/2teaspoonfreshly ground black pepper
Instructions
Preheat the oven to 400 degrees. Lightly grease a round 9 in (23 cm) or square 9x9 in (23x23 cm) casserole dish.
Toss the cauliflower with olive oil. Sprinkle lightly with sea salt and black pepper. And roast in prepared pan for 15-20 minutes, stirring halfway through, until crisp-tender.
Meanwhile, cook the onion in a skillet for 8-10 minutes over medium-low heat, until translucent and slightly browned.
Add the ground beef. Increase heat to medium-high. Cook for about 8-10 minutes, breaking apart with a spatula, until browned.
Stir in the garlic, marinara sauce, diced tomatoes, and half of the fresh basil. Season with sea salt and black pepper to taste. Cook for 2 minutes, until heated through.
Pour the tomato meat sauce over the cauliflower. Sprinkle with shredded mozzarella cheese, and bake for an additional 8-10 minutes, until the cheese bubbles. Top with the remaining fresh basil ribbons.
Reheating Instructions
Heat in a 350 oven until heated through or in the microwave on medium-high power.
